jupyter notebook没有cell
时间: 2024-05-19 14:09:59 浏览: 660
Jupyter Notebook是一种开源的Web应用程序,可以让用户创建和共享文档,其中包含实时代码、方程式、可视化和描述性文本等。 Jupyter Notebook将代码和代码输出、文本注释和可视化组合在一起,使得数据分析和交互式编程变得更加容易。
如果你在Jupyter Notebook中没有cell,可能是因为你没有创建任何cell。在Jupyter Notebook中,cell是一种基本的单元,用于组织和运行代码。要创建一个新的cell,请点击页面顶部的“Insert”按钮,并选择“Insert Cell Above”或“Insert Cell Below”。
如果你已经创建了cell但它们不显示出来,可能是因为你隐藏了它们。你可以通过单击cell左侧的小箭头或者使用“View”菜单中的选项来显示或隐藏cell。
相关问题
jupyter notebook 没有cell
看起来您可能对Jupyter Notebook的界面有些误解。实际上,在Jupyter Notebook中,每个文本区域就是一个被称为"单元格" (cell) 的基本工作单位。单元格用于编写和运行Python代码、执行数学计算、创建 Markdown 文本段落甚至是包含HTML代码。要创建新单元格,您可以按照以下步骤操作:
1. **启动Jupyter Notebook**:确保您已安装Jupyter,并从命令行或终端中运行`jupyter notebook`。
2. **打开文件夹或创建新笔记本**:访问您想要工作的目录,或点击`New` -> `Python 3` 来创建一个新的空白 notebook 文件。
3. **查看界面**:在浏览器窗口中,你会看到一个带有许多灰色或白色边框的区域,这就是单元格的容器。
4. **插入新单元格**:在工具栏上,找到"Insert"部分,这里有"Insert Cell Above" 和 "Insert Cell Below" 两个按钮,分别用来在当前单元格上方或下方添加新的空白单元格。
如果您确实无法找到单元格选项,可能是版本过旧或者是界面定制的问题。更新到最新版的Jupyter Notebook或检查是否有特别的视图设置可能会有所帮助。
jupyter notebook折叠cell
### 如何在 Jupyter Notebook 中折叠或隐藏单元格
在 Jupyter Notebook 中,可以通过多种方式来实现单元格内容的折叠或隐藏功能。
对于代码单元格而言,在执行完代码之后,默认情况下输出会完全显示出来。如果希望收起这些输出,可以在运行完该单元格后点击左侧方括号中的`stdout`字样旁边的蓝色按钮,这将会把输出部分收缩起来[^1]。
另外一种更为灵活的方式是利用 `IPython.display` 模块下的 `HTML()` 函数配合 HTML 和 JavaScript 来创建可交互式的折叠面板:
```python
from IPython.display import display, HTML
html_code = """
<div>
<button onclick="toggleVisibility('myDiv')">Toggle visibility</button>
<div id="myDiv" style="display:none;">
<!-- 这里放置想要被折叠的内容 -->
Hidden content.
</div>
</div>
<script type="text/javascript">
function toggleVisibility(id) {
var e = document.getElementById(id);
if (e.style.display == 'block')
e.style.display = 'none';
else
e.style.display = 'block';
}
</script>
"""
display(HTML(html_code))
```
上述方法允许用户通过点击按钮来自由切换指定区域内的内容可见与否的状态。
为了更方便地管理较长篇幅的文字或者复杂的多行代码展示,还可以安装第三方扩展如 `jupyter_contrib_nbextensions` ,其中包含了名为 "Collapsible Headings" 的插件可以提供更加直观便捷的操作体验。
阅读全文
相关推荐
















